Output ebd17c181c7333f3b7e6be2d3cddb6d1bca0357f7e64c08ab391099e13f1c873:62

value
104594
script pubkey
OP_0 OP_PUSHBYTES_20 c252baba2508ff147558d5fb79abfdb1aaf01944
address
bc1qcfft4w39prl3ga2c6hahn2lakx40qx2y958xgm
transaction
ebd17c181c7333f3b7e6be2d3cddb6d1bca0357f7e64c08ab391099e13f1c873